The Heart of the Flight: Join Ventura Air Services as a Charter Cabin Attendant

Based in Farmingdale, NY - serving premier airports across the Eastern U.S., we believe our cabin attendants aren't just crew members—they are the soul of every journey. From the first warm greeting as a client steps aboard to the final farewell on the tarmac, you shape the entire experience. You are our eyes and ears at altitude, the face of our brand, and the person who knows our aircraft and our clients better than anyone else. Everything we build behind the scenes comes to life through you. If you're someone who notices the small details that others overlook, takes genuine pride in making people feel at ease, and understands that true hospitality is an art form, we would love to meet you.

What You'll Do:
  • Keep the cabin running smoothly – Stay observant and report any issues to the Pilot in Command while keeping all company paperwork accurate and up to date.
  • Welcome passengers like guests in your home – Assist with luggage, help with carry-ons, and create a relaxed, personalized atmosphere from the very first step onboard.
  • Deliver hospitality that feels effortless – Handle beverage and catering service with polish and poise, anticipating special requests before a client even asks.
  • Be a calming presence – Whether facing weather delays or mid-flight turbulence, your confidence and composure will reassure everyone onboard.
  • Maintain a pristine cabin – Take pride in keeping every surface, corner, and detail looking its absolute best.
Who We're Looking For.

We welcome entry-level candidates who have a natural flair for service. That said, a background in executive-level hospitality, fine dining, or culinary arts is a strong plus— but not a requirement. More than anything, we're looking for the right attitude.

Qualifications
  • A genuine passion for connecting with people and delivering thoughtful, attentive service.
  • Strong communication skills and the ability to read any room with ease.
  • Discretion, trustworthiness, and a professional presence at all times.
  • Excellent organizational habits—you can juggle multiple tasks without dropping the ball.
  • Comfort with domestic and international travel.
  • Eligibility to work in the U.S. and the ability to pass a background check.
Where You'll Be Based.

You must live within two hours of one of the following airports:

  • New York area: JFK, LaGuardia, Newark.
  • Boston, Philadelphia, Washington DC: Logan, Philadelphia International, Dulles, BWI.
  • Southeast: Raleigh-Durham, Charlotte, Atlanta, Fort Lauderdale, Miami, Tampa, Orlando, Jacksonville.
  • Midwest: Chicago O'Hare, Detroit Metro, Minneapolis-Saint Paul, Indianapolis, St. Louis Lambert, Kansas City International, Nashville.
  • Texas: Dallas/Fort Worth, Austin-Bergstrom, George Bush Intercontinental (Houston).
  • Plus: Denver International.
Physical & Practical Realities
  • Lift and carry items up to 50 pounds.
  • Stay on your feet for extended periods in a compact cabin environment.
  • Be prepared to assist passengers in emergency situations.
  • Work irregular schedules, including weekends, holidays, and long duty days (holidays are our busiest season, so those shifts will be part of your rotation).
What Makes This Role Different

No two flights are ever the same. Our charter operation moves fast, and our passengers vary with every trip. You'll need to think quickly, adapt on the fly, and embrace the unpredictable nature of private aviation. If you thrive on variety and love the challenge of making every client feel like the only person in the room, you'll fit right in.

Compensation

Starting pay is $62,000 per year and up, depending on your experience and background.
